Radiation Test Engineer

Astranis
San Francisco
Workplace: OnsiteFull timeUSD 120,000 - 145,000 annuallyFunction: QA, Test & Release EngineeringEducation: bachelorsSkills: ["Hands-on development","Fault-tolerance focus","Collaboration","Testing mindset","Fast-paced execution"]

Analyze and test spacecraft candidate electronics for radiation environments used in aerospace applications. Support fault-tolerant electrical system design and simulate GEO/GTO radiation conditions on PCBA designs. Plan and run radiation testing campaigns to upscreen components, and help translate fault-tolerant systems into spacecraft operations alongside the broader engineering team. Assist with other electrical design, bringup, and test activities and contribute to hiring as the team grows rapidly.

Company Brief

Astranis
Designs and manufactures small geostationary communications satellites to provide affordable broadband connectivity to underserved regions using proprietary microGEO satellite technology and integrated ground systems.
